How a third party fits into your workflow
Engaging an external provider typically begins with a clear definition of responsibilities, timing, and data access. The right partner integrates with your accounting system, imports historical data, and establishes a cadence for monthly closes. Regular communication channels, standardised formats, and secure data handling procedures are essential. This collaboration creates a seamless rhythm where reports are prepared consistently, enabling faster decision making and better forecasting without adding internal workload.
Selecting the right service partner
When evaluating options, consider the scope of services, industry experience, and pricing models. A solid agreement outlines who handles accounts payable and receivable, payroll integration, and tax support. Look for evidence of quality controls, client references, and transparent performance metrics. The best firms offer scalable plans that match business growth, ensuring you are not paying for capabilities you do not yet need while retaining room to expand as requirements evolve.
Security and access considerations
Security is a top concern when sharing financial information with an outsourced team. Ensure firms enforce role based access, encryption in transit and at rest, and robust audit trails. A reputable provider will also explain data retention policies and disaster recovery plans. By prioritising data protection, you protect sensitive insights and maintain confidence that confidential data remains secure, even when accessed remotely.
